    Moving to town and we ate here two nights in a row. Such a family friendly atmosphere with a wonderful menu. I had a great salmon, mango, and avocado salad the first night. Tried the crab and avocado salad the next night. Any salad with the secret balsamic dressing is going to be my new craving. Kids had the homemade Alfredo and it was excellent.

    We really enjoyed Tchefuncte's!…read more They have their own parking lot, so it made it very easy to get in and out. You just park, the go inside, and the restaurant is on the 2nd floor. The service was phenomenal! It was for an anniversary, and they made sure to tell us happy anniversary, and add it to a little sign that was left on our table. Now for the main part: the food. Fried Oysters and Pork Belly - very good, if you get this make sure you eat them together (that was our "best bite" for that serving). Wedge Salad - one of the best wedge salad's we have had. The blue cheese dressing was creamy (rather than chunky blue cheese). It had crispy shoestring onion strings that almost acted as the croutons. I loved every bite that included lettuce, tomatoes, onion, and bacon. Delmonico Steak - this was probably our overall favorite item. Just a great steak, and large enough for both of us to enjoy. Redfish - this was good, not great. Would probably try something else other than this if we went back. Tchefuncte Potatoes - they almost were like a twice baked potato (flavor wise), but they are super creamy and fluffy and then turned into a lightly fried ball. Good and very unique. Crème Brûlée - if you like crème brûlée then you will enjoy it here. A classic dessert that was delicious. And to top it all off, the ambiance was great. It is right on the water, and service was very attentive.
